May View Fishermans CottageMayView is a 17th century fisherman's cottage, so called as out of its window the Isle of May can be clearly seen. It accommodates a maximum of two adults and one small child.

MayView is located next to the picturesque Crail Harbour, which is much photographed. The cottage has been carefully restored, with no expense spared on fittings, retaining its original stone walls throughout which are complemented by a solid walnut floor and the original 17th century beams.

MayView Cottage living room has a log burning stove, the window seat set in the stone wall affords fine views across the Firth of Forth to the Isle of May. The kitchen includes a double ceramic hob, fridge, microwave, toaster, a full compliment of pots and pans, crockery and crystal glasses.

Crail Harbour by Fishermans CottageThe large bedroom has a king sized bed, the triple aspect dormer seat, provides uninterrupted views down the Firth of Forth and over to the Isle of May. There is a travel cot and a fold-out single bed suitable for a small child.

MayView is supplied with Egyptian cotton linen, cot and bedding (if required), towels, beach towels, two luxury bath robes, coffee, tea, sugar and toiletries (soap, shower gel, etc).

The bathroom has a luxury claw-foot spa bath with pressurised six-inch rain shower.
